Across TCGA patient cohorts, RAPGEF6 protein abundance is significantly associated with the RNA expression of many other genes, with 927 significant associations in total. LUAD shows the largest number of these associations.

The most reproducible RAPGEF6-associated genes across cancer lineages are MRPS24, LRTM2, and LINC02873. Each is linked with RAPGEF6 in more than 1 cancer types. Because this analysis shows association rather than direction, both RAPGEF6-to-partner and partner-to-RAPGEF6 results are reported.

Each partner links to its own Q-omics profile. The scatter plot shows the strongest example, RAPGEF6 versus MRPS24 in HNSC, with a Pearson correlation of -0.82.
